Description
Extendable and adjustable floor lamp by Maison Lunel.
Made entirely of polished brass. The double “diabolo” shade is mounted on a ball-and-socket joint, allowing it to be swivelled into the desired position.
Minimum height: 140 cm (55.12 inches)
Maximum height: 180 cm (70.9 inches)
Lampshade diameter: 40 cm (15.75 inches)
Overall depth: 84 cm (33.1 inches)
Story
LUNEL is a French lighting manufacturer associated with the modern creative movement for its creations close to those of the first French designers. The LUNEL publishing house has notably popularized the use of lacquered tubular metal or even brass in the creation of lighting fixtures.
Suspensions, lamps, wall lights or floor lamps, many of the pieces published by LUNEL are made in a simple, sober and refined style, with an easily identifiable design, which makes it a very popular publisher among collectors. -
